CF (Counterfeit Detection) – This unit is defaulted to the ideal setting to be used for detecting fake or
suspect bills when counting Canadian or USA banknotes.
During operation, if this unit detects an error due to one of these methods, the machine will stop
counting to allow for removal of the suspect bill and a descriptive error code will display. To resume
counting, press 'ENTER/START'
Ultraviolet Counterfeit Detection (UV)
The Ultraviolet detector will look for suspect bills that use white or bleached paper.
Magnetic Counterfeit Detection (MG)
The Magnetic detector will look for the presence of magnetic components that are standard in
authentic bills.
Infrared Counterfeit Detection (IR)
The Infrared sensors detect double and half notes and verifies proper dimensional specifications
